Cisco ASR9k'ta SNMP üzerinden optik iletim gücünü nasıl okurum?


13

ASR9k'umuzdaki XFP'lerin optik iletimini ve gücünü almak istiyorum. Kullanılan MIB, 1.3.6.1.4.1.9.9.91 olan ve ASR9000 belgelerine göre "CISCO-ENTITY-SENSOR-MIB" olmalıdır, bu ASR9k'ta mevcuttur: http://www.cisco.com/tr/TR /docs/routers/asr9000/mib/guide/asr9kmib3.html#wp2293135 Yukarı kaydırırsanız, MIB'nin desteklenen listede olduğunu görürsünüz.

Yani, sorum: Bir şey eksik mi ve bu bilgiler SNMP tarafından kullanılabilir mi yoksa Cisco belgeleri burada yanlış mı? Ve eğer mevcutsa, bu bilgilere nasıl ulaşabilirim?

Ancak snmp mib nesne adını göster | i 1.3.6.1.4.1.9.9.91 hiçbir şey bana ne snmp mib nesne adı göstermez | i Sensörü

RP / 0 / RSP0 / CPU0: yönlendirici # göster snmp mib nesne adı | i 1.3.6.1.4.1.9.9.91 Per 16 Mayıs 09: 08: 01.679 CET RP / 0 / RSP0 / CPU0: yönlendirici # show snmp mib nesne adı | 16 Mayıs Perşembe günü [09] 08: 19.017 CET

Sürüm:

RP / 0 / RSP0 / CPU0: yönlendirici # sürümü göster May 16 May 09: 07: 14.437 CET

Cisco IOS XR Yazılımı, Sürüm 4.2.3 [Varsayılan] Telif Hakkı (c) 2012, Cisco Systems, Inc.

ROM: Sistem Önyükleme, Sürüm 1.06 (20120210: 003513) [ASR9K ROMMON],

cn-asd-kl-cr15 çalışma süresi 23 hafta, 3 gün, 1 saat, 12 dakikadır Sistem görüntü dosyası "bootflash: disk0 / asr9k-os-mbi-4.2.3 / 0x100000 / mbiasr9k-rp.vm"

4194304K bayt belleğe sahip cisco ASR9K Serisi (MPC8641D) işlemci. 1333 MHz'de MPC8641D işlemci, PEM Sürüm 2 ile Revizyon 2.2 ASR 9006 AC Şasi

Ve okumaya çalışıyorum XFP:

RP / 0 / RSP0 / CPU0: yönlendirici # envanteri göster AD:: modül 0/0 / CPU0 ", DESCR:" 8-Port 10GE Düşük Kuyruk Hattı Kartı, XFP gerektirir "PID: A9K-8T-L, VID: V04, SN: FOC1641N6EH

ADI: "modül mau TenGigE0 / 0 / CPU0 / 0", DESCR: "Çok oranlı 10GBASE-LR ve OC-192 / STM-64 SR-1 XFP, SMF" PID: XFP-10GLR-OC192SR, VID: V04, SN: SPC1623090S

Karşılaştırmak için, bu bizim 7606'nın çıktısıdır:

7606 # show ver Cisco IOS Yazılımı, c7600s72033_rp Yazılımı (c7600s72033_rp-ADVIPSERVICESK9-M), Sürüm 15.1 (3) S4, SÜRÜM YAZILIMI (fc2)

7606 # gösteri snmp mib | i Sensör entPhySensorType entPhySensorScale entPhySensorPrecision entPhySensorValue entPhySensorOperStatus entPhySensorUnitsDisplay entPhySensorValueTimeStamp entPhySensorValueUpdateRate entSensorType entSensorScale entSensorPrecision entSensorValue entSensorStatus entSensorValueTimeStamp entSensorValueUpdateRate entSensorMeasuredEntity entSensorThresholdSeverity entSensorThresholdRelation entSensorThresholdValue entSensorThresholdEvaluation entSensorThresholdNotificationEnable

Yanıtlar:


9

Söz konusu MIB / OID'leri bir yönetim istasyonundan yürümeyi denediniz mi? Ürün yazılımı KG ile çok fazla zaman geçirdikten sonra, OID'ler kirlenebilir olduğunda bile show komutlarının doğru bilgileri göstermeyeceğini fark ettim. Kaktüsler, obsidyum vb. Bilgileri yok etmeye çalışmadan önce Net-SNMP araçlarını ve araçlarını hata ayıklama olarak kullanmayı ve bilmenizi öneririm.

örneğin snmpwalk -v2c -c <community> <routername> 1.3.6.1.4.1.9.9.91, "Bu aracıda bu aracıda kullanılabilir böyle bir nesne yok" diyecek

1.3.6.1.4.1.9 IOS-XE kutumda yürümek çok şey veriyor (sadece açıklama için MIB'leri eklemem gerekiyor). Sonra çalışacak bir şeyim var (izleme için bana fayda sağlayabilecek diğer taşlar dahil)

snmpwalk -v2c -c <community> <routername> 1.3.6.1.4.1.9

ASR 9000 @ üzerinde 4.2.x için mevcut olan MIB'lere göz atın:

ftp://ftp.cisco.com/pub/mibs/supportlists/asr9000/asr9000-supportlist.html#Supported_and_Verified_MIBs_XE_4_2_X

Bu bağlantı, CISCO-ENTITY-SENSOR-MIB'nin kullanılabilir olduğunu ve 2007'den beri güncellenmediğini söylüyor. Düzenleme: ASR9000'de eşlendiği gibi asr9k-mgbl-p.pie paketinin yönlendiricide bulunmadığı anlaşılıyor Yukarıdaki MIB listesi.

Ek bilgi:

Cisco'nun MIB Konum Belirleme aracı yalnızca IOS'dur, bu nedenle daha fazla bilgi için FTP bağlantısında asr9000'in üstündeki dizinlere bakın.

Araç: http://tools.cisco.com/ITDIT/MIBS/MainServlet

SNMP ftp dizini: ftp://ftp.cisco.com/pub/mibs/supportlists/

MIB'leri yükleme hakkında daha fazla bilgi için: http://www.cisco.com/en/US/tech/tk648/tk362/technologies_tech_note09186a00800b4cee.shtml

Gerçekten iyi bir Cisco SNMP bağlantı sayfası: http://www.cisco.com/en/US/tech/tk648/tk362/tk605/tsd_technology_support_sub-protocol_home.html


Cisco IOS XR Yönetilebilirlik Paketini (asr9k-mgbl-p.pie) eksik gibi görünüyor. Bunu bir sonraki servis penceresinde güncelleyeceğim. Çok teşekkür ederim.
JelmerS

asr9k-mgbl-p.pie eksikti? Muhtemelen bir yükseltmeden mi? Her iki durumda da, bulduğum SNMP bağlantılarına
tutunuyorum

Bu LIR'da yeniyim, bu yüzden eksik turtanın arkasındaki nedeni bilmiyorum. Ancak, farklı bir ASR'de, pasta IS yüklüdür ve gerçekten mW'de Tx ve Rx gücünü alabilirim.
JelmerS

4

1.3.6.1.4.1.9.9.91 mib, en azından ASR1001'lerde çalışır.

İzleme kutumdan aşağıdakileri çalıştırmak:

snmpwalk -v2c -c <community-string> <asr1001-name> 1.3.6.1.4.1.9.9.91

Aşağıdakilerin çıktısını verir:

CISCO-ENTITY-SENSOR-MIB::entSensorType.4 = INTEGER: amperes(5)
CISCO-ENTITY-SENSOR-MIB::entSensorType.5 = INTEGER: voltsAC(3)
CISCO-ENTITY-SENSOR-MIB::entSensorType.6 = INTEGER: voltsAC(3)
CISCO-ENTITY-SENSOR-MIB::entSensorType.7 = INTEGER: celsius(8)
CISCO-ENTITY-SENSOR-MIB::entSensorType.8 = INTEGER: celsius(8)

Ve bunun gibi. Sadece dizine eklemeniz ve izlemek istediğiniz sensörü bulmanız yeterlidir.

(Not olarak, okunabilir çıktı elde etmek için snmpwalk kaynaklı sunucuya CISCO-ENTITY-SENSOR-MIB'yi kurmam gerekiyordu.)


0

Aşağıdaki bağlantı sizin için yararlı olabilir:

https://supportforums.cisco.com/discussion/12577221/snmp-polling-optical-budget-dbm


1
Sadece bağlantıya verilen cevaplar kesinlikle kaşlarını çatmıştır. Bu sitenin bir arşiv olması amaçlanmıştır ve bağlantılar zaman içinde değişir veya kaybolur. Bağlantıdan ilgili metni alıntı yapmanız ve alıntıyı doğru bir şekilde ilişkilendirmek için bağlantıyı eklemeniz gerekir. Bunu açıklamaya çalışırsanız daha iyi olur.
Ron Maupin
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.